Benghazi – The giant ship “CMA CGM HYVAN” berthed at the Juliyana Free Zone port. This move reflects the growing maritime activity at the port. It also enhances its readiness to receive large container ships.
The docking process followed precise maritime pilotage. The specialized team successfully guided the ship to the pier. They completed the mooring process with full safety.
Samir Al-Nabal, head of the Marine Services Department, spoke about the operation. He stated that the maritime pilotage team showed high efficiency. Sailor and pilot Yousef Al-Bijwa led the team. They guided and secured the ship with professionalism.
Workers began unloading containers from the ship after it docked. They used modern Liebherr cranes for the task. This aims to accelerate the pace of work. It also improves the efficiency of operational processes within the port.
